    CNC Plasma Profile cutting Machine

    hi

    i plan to buy a CNC plama profile cutting machine. I have taken quotes from different suppliers. Most of them are giving me the hypertherm plasma source. I am not able to make a decision between the powermax 1650 , HSD130 and HPR130. i understand there is a major diff between the 1650 and the other two but i am not able to understand the difference between the HSD130 and the HPR130.

    My work is of sheet metal cutting for transformer tanks. Quality is not a major criteria but production cost and production time is. I plan to cut sheets of about 3000x6300 at a time. The tolerances can be till 0.5mm . I am not able to find out which one would be most economical for me and what is the diff in price of these models.

    Here's the scoop on the 3 Hypertherm systems you mention....the Powermax1650, the HSD130 and the HPR130.

    There are 3 distinct classes of plasma systems in Hypertherms product line:

    1. Entry level air plasma systems. These systems are relatively low cost...primarily focused on hand held torch cutting although most models are offered with machine torches and interfaces to connect to cnc cutting machines. These systems have air cooled torches....can be expected to produce parts with tolerances typically in the plus or minus .030" range. Design duty cycles are typically from 35% to 70% depending on application. They are a good choice for mechanized cutting applications that require low capital equipment cost...medium production and tolerance levels...but do not require high duty cycles and when production costs (cost per foot of cut) are not important

    Hypertherm systems included in this air plasma classification are: Powermax190c, Powermax30, Powermax45, Powermax1000, Powermax1250 and Powermax1650, 12, 30, 45, 60, 80 and 100 Amps respectively. We also have a Max200 which is a 200 Amp liquid cooled torch that is available with a hand torch or a machine torch....and can use a variety of different gases for fine tuning the cutting process.

    2. Mechanized conventional plasma systems. These systems are designed for mechanized applications only....hand cutting torches are not available. These systems are designed for high production cutting at medium tolerance levels at 100% duty cycle. Mounted on good quality cutting machines these systems can hold tolerances in the plus or minus .020" range....and have the ability to use oxygen as the plasma gas for better edge metalurgy (softer, more weldable, less dross formation)....and provide the Hypertherm Long-Life consumable technology that dramatically improves operating cost through extremely long consumable life. The systems included in this category are the HSD130, HT2000, HT4400 and HT4001.....with 130, 200, 400 and 400 amp water injection cutting process capability. Capital equipment costs are in the medium range with these systems.

    3. Mechanized Hyperformance plasma systems. Hyperformance is Hypertherms trade name for our high definition class plasma systems, usable only for mechanized cutting. These systems utilize a special vented nozzle design along with a floating cooling tube and our Long Life consumable technology to provide higher energy density at the arc....which means a narrower kerf, high cutting speeds, the ability to mark and cut with the same consumables, and extremely tight tolerances and edge squareness for plasma. Due to the fact that there is minimal need for any secondary operations after cutting with these systems...combined with by far...the longest consumable life in the business...make these Hyperformance systems have the lowest operating cost with the highest productivity. Capital equipments costs are high with these systems....but when used in high productive environments can provide a quick return on investment due to excellent cut quality and low operating cost. Typical cut part accuracies are in the .010 to .015" range. Hypertherm systems in this class are the HPR130, HPR260 and HPR400xd.....with 130, 260 and 400 amps.


    If you truly need to hold tolerances in the .5mm range on a production basis...then you should probably consider the HPR130.....as it will provide the best possible cut quality on sheet steel....while providing a metalurgically pure edge and high production levels.

    The 1650 plasma system sels in the $5,500 range, the HSD130 is in the $25,000 range and the HSD130 is in the $35,000 range....these are US dolars....and will vary depending on how the systems are equipped.

    You did not mention your needs as far as maximum and minimum thickness requirements, types of metals being cut....or requirements concerning produstion rates and speeds. Also....better plasma systems require better cutting machines and height control systems in order to achieve their full potential......you do not want to put a $34,000 Hyperformance plasma on a low cost, entry level cnc machine...it would not make sense!

    My work is on mild steel. Most of the sheets that ill have 2 cut will be 5-6mm and max 16mm for good quality work. Currently I am using shearing machine and press to cut the sheets and the holes in the sheet. I plan to cut about 5 tonne material per day on the cnc plasma. So i need to justify the cost of shifting to cnc plasma and accordingly select the plasma source. Also i need to estimate the time that ill save by using the selected plasma source.


    The cnc options that I have are:-

    1. Messer Multitherm Eco 3000x6300(working track dimensions)

    2. Kunshan Pushan make cnc with hyperthem edge II controller
    2.1. Nesting software is FASTCAM
    2.2. PHC height control system

    Both use hypertherm plasma source.

    Also is the hyspeed HT2000 cheaper than the HSD130?
